Indicators are … WebJan 7, 2008 · Guarded: Condition, where things are not clear, can have poor outcome and can go either way. Stable: Where vitals are normal, although the diagnosis had been life threatening. Critical: Where vitals parameters are unstable and diagnosis is life threatening, with real danger of death. Indicators are questionable.... WebOct 18, 1999 · As one doc told me, critical condition, by definition, requires care in a critical care or intensive care unit. In general, it’s the worst condition (other than, obviously, DOA) a patient can be in, with a high risk of death within the next 24 hours.
